A man discusses his childhood in Lahaina. He describes his different jobs at the plantation and involvement with union strikes.
sugar plantation laborer, sugar plantation supervisor, sugar plantation crane operator, sugar plantation mill worker, union officer; Hawaiian-Portuguese-Irish; male
Interview conducted in English.
